Strahan's House On The Market

Wednesday, September 3, 2008

Here's the listing description from the GSMLS (listing agent is Coldwell Banker) Coldwell Banker...

strahanhouse.jpg
Introducing Daybreak, Montclair's most prestigious estate meticulously restored with museum quality details and fixtures. Never before has a home of this quality and scale been available in Montclair. Open house to be announced at later date. Must be prequalified. LA [listing agent] to accompany all showings.

Just so we don't confuse Strahan's house at 99 Lloyd Road with another Daybreak, we go to an explanation here from Baristaville historian Frank GG.

Here are the numbers on the Strahan estate: $7,750,000 gets you 2.3 acres, 30 rooms (10 bedrooms), 5 fireplaces, 10 car garage, and annual taxes of $82,418. No photos with the listing yet, but here's a look at one of the bathrooms. Update: The Star-Ledger picks up the story.
